Transaction cc655031e5f69889bc5f12341a96a8cde8cb23ee2a4712719351814560b50c34
1 Input
1 Output
-
cc655031e5f69889bc5f12341a96a8cde8cb23ee2a4712719351814560b50c34:0
- value
- 1538407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f911046e30d60f278de4137a3a817b1b5b4ad522 OP_EQUAL
- address
- 3QPxZh8WX179e69gAJCUzSayu3iQppPDNi